Colombian Rescuer Recounts Harrowing Search for Survivors After Venezuela Earthquakes

Africa2 hr ago

A member of the Usar Colombia rescue team has shared a harrowing account of their ten-day mission to find survivors following devastating earthquakes in Venezuela. The rescuer described the intense, time-sensitive nature of the search operations. The city was overwhelmed by the smell of death, highlighting the scale of the tragedy. Among the many heartbreaking incidents, the team encountered a particularly painful case involving a party where approximately 50 children tragically did not survive. The experience underscored the immense challenges and emotional toll faced by rescue workers in the aftermath of such natural disasters. The Colombian team's efforts were a race against time, battling immense destruction and the grim reality of loss.
